Alla Tovares is Professor of Linguistics in the Department of English at Howard University's College of Arts & Sciences. She also serves as Director of Undergraduate Studies in English, demonstrating leadership in academic administration. Her work bridges linguistic theory, social discourse, and digital culture.
Research Interests: Dr. Tovares specializes in sociolinguistics, with a focus on language ideologies, conflict discourse (particularly in the context of Russia’s war in Ukraine), and digital food discourse. Her research examines how identity, power, and ideology are constructed through online communication, especially in food-related social media interactions. She investigates narrative strategies, stance-taking, humor, and authenticity in digital environments.
Her recent publications reflect a consistent engagement with discourse analysis across platforms such as blogs, forums, vlogs, and social media. Themes include mediatized food talk, transnational food narratives, and the role of language in shaping community and conflict. This body of work reveals a strong interdisciplinary orientation linking linguistics with media studies, cultural anthropology, and digital sociology.
